Manchester United striker Alexis Sanchez has hit out at his critics after impressing at the Copa America.
Alexis has fired Chile to the Copa America semi-finals.
The forward kept his cool and scored from the spot to secure a 5-4 penalty shoot-out victory over Colombia on Saturday.
The forward had a few bitter words for his critics on social media.
Sanchez posted a photo of him celebrating without a shirt after his goal set Chile up for a Copa America semi-finals clash against Peru.
And he added words that read: "They profited, they healed, they talked s**t about me. And I stayed quiet.
"They slandered, they even locked in on me, but there is a judge up above (there is one up there)."
The Chilean actually quoted lyrics from Puerto Rican reggaeton artist Farruko's song "Delincuente".
